Orbi RBR750 WiFi - SSID Not visible on some devices
Hi, I have recently purchased the Orbi mesh system but unfortunately one of my devices (the most important one!) wont recognise the SSID. The device is the HP Elite x 2 using Windows 10 version 1803.
Any help would be most appreciated, especially as the reason I purchased the Orbi was to improve wifi strength for use of the device that is not picking up the SSID.

Dougjc25 wrote:Hi, I have recently purchased the Orbi mesh system but unfortunately one of my devices (the most important one!) wont recognise the SSID. The device is the HP Elite x 2 using Windows 10 version 1803.
First, check with HP and the wireless network adapter vendor to install the latest drivers. The older driver software sometimes has issues with newer wi-fi conventions like the Orbi AX systems use.
To improve Orbi AX compatibility with older wireless devices, go to orbilogin.com and in Advanced... Advanced... Wireless Settings set CTS/RTS Threshold to 2347 for both bands. If that is insufficient, try disabling (uncheck) AX Mode for 2.4Ghz in Advanced... Setup... Wireless Setup.
